Alumni of the month: Arno Ahosniemi, Executive Editor-in-Chief, Kauppalehti

Alumni of the month is a news series of interviews where we feature Henley Business School alumni from various fields of business. In the interviews, our alumni share what were the most important lessons they learned during their studies and how studying at Henley has impacted both the career and personal life. In addition, you will also get insights on what are the keys to success in each alumnusโ€™ field of business.

1. What were the most important lessons you learned at Henley Business School?

The most important lesson was deepening my knowledge in different areas of corporate governance, including funding, strategy, responsibility, and HR. I also learned to approach problems from new perspectives and, of course, had the chance to build networks with interesting people.

2. In what ways did studying at Henley change your life?

It feels easier to tackle problems at work now that I have more theoretical knowledge. I have also honed my information seeking skills that are needed for fixing the problems.

3. What is the importance of networks in todayโ€™s business?

The importance of networking has not diminished in todayโ€™s working life โ€“ quite the opposite. Although various digital channels enable easy communication, personal contacts remain extremely important. No-one can succeed alone in working life. The key to all development is rich discussion with different individuals.

4. What is happening in your field at the moment, what are the keys to success?  

In the media sector, digitalisation and the availability of easy production methods have been the most significant change drivers for a long time now. Today, anyone can produce text, video and audio material and share them on a range of digital channels. The winners swear by reliable content, strong brands, ability to change and digitalised products. It is also important to understand technology and have an idea of how to manage a digital organisation.
